In the fast-paced pharmaceutical industry, efficiency and compliance are non-negotiable. LMS Scientific Solution Sdn Bhd, the exclusive distributor of Raytor Instruments in Malaysia, is proud to present the Raytor RT9 Series Multi-batch Automatic Dissolution System.
The RT9 Series is a groundbreaking solution designed to eliminate the bottlenecks of manual labor. It is engineered to perform up to 10 consecutive batches of dissolution testing in a completely unattended environment. From media dispensing and testing to thorough vessel cleaning and data logging, the RT9 handles the entire workflow with surgical precision, making it the ideal choice for high-throughput Quality Control (QC) and R&D laboratories across Malaysia.

Key Features & Benefits
- 10-Batch Unattended Operation: Boost your lab’s productivity by running 10 full cycles without human intervention.
- Fully Integrated Media Management: Automated high-precision media dispensing and removal ensure consistent “sink conditions.”
- Thorough Automated Cleaning: Features a “dead-angle-free” spray technique to eliminate cross-contamination between batches.
- Advanced Data Integrity: Built-in software fully complies with FDA 21 CFR Part 11, featuring audit trails, electronic signatures, and multi-level user management.
- Precision Control: Temperature accuracy of ≤ ±0.5℃ and speed resolution of 0.1 RPM for repeatable, reliable results.
USP Apparatus 1 & 2 Compliance
The Raytor RT9 Series is designed in strict accordance with global pharmacopoeia standards, including the USP, EP, and ChP. It seamlessly supports the two most common dissolution methods:
- USP Apparatus 1 (Basket Method): Ideal for capsules and tablets that require containment during the dissolution process.
- USP Apparatus 2 (Paddle Method): The standard for immediate-release, enteric-coated, and extended-release tablets.

Unlike standard systems that require a technician to empty and clean vessels after every run, the RT9 is integrated with a media management workstation and a robotic system. It automatically dispenses media, runs the test, collects samples, drains the vessels, performs a self-cleaning cycle, and begins the next batch immediately.
The RT9 uses an optimized automated spray cleaning system. It performs a thorough “dead-angle-free” wash of the vessels and lines between each batch, which can be customized based on your specific cleaning fluid requirements.
- Automated Sampling (RT6-ST): The system pulls the sample at the right time and replaces the media. A human still needs to clean the machine for the next test.
- Multi-batch Automation (RT9): The system handles the entire lifecycle of 10 separate tests. You load the samples, and the RT9 does everything else for the next 10 runs.

SPECIFICATIONS
- Number of Positions: 6 Dissolving Cup Positions
- Speed Range: 20-250 rpm
- Speed Resolution: 0.1 rpm
- Temperature Range: Room Temperature to 50°C
- Temperature Resolution: 0.1°C
- Temperature Accuracy: ≤±0.5°C
- Vessel Verticality: 90°±0.5°
- Shaft Verticality: 90°±0.5°
- Centering Deviation: < ±2.0 mm
- Depth Positioning Deviation: < ±1.0 mm
- Shaft Wobble: < ±1.0 mm
- Basket Wobble: < ±1.0 mm
- Software: Supports FDA 21 CFR Part 11 requirements
- Temp range: Room temperature to 45°C
- Degassing Effect: Oxygen ≤ 3ppm
- Degassing Volume: ≥50L
- Maximum Settable Sample Number: 20
- Sampling Range: 5 ~ 20ml
- Sampling Precision: ≤±1%
